Get in Touch** The general auto repair market for Thurman, Iowa, is characterized by its reliance on neighboring towns, primarily Sidney, which serves as the Fremont County seat and commercial hub. The competition level is moderate, with a handful of established, long-standing shops serving the rural population. These businesses typically have deep community roots, with many operating for decades, which speaks to their reputation and reliability. The quality of service is generally high, with an emphasis on building long-term customer relationships—a necessity in a small, tight-knit community. Pricing is typically competitive and fair, often more affordable than in larger urban centers, reflecting the local cost of living. For specialized services or specific brand expertise, residents may need to travel to larger cities like Council Bluffs or Omaha.

Rural gravel and dirt roads around Thurman and Fremont County lead to frequent issues with suspension components, shock absorbers, and increased wear on brakes due to dust. Additionally, potholes from seasonal freeze-thaw cycles can cause alignment problems and tire damage, making regular inspections important.
Seek service immediately for any unusual noises from the suspension or steering, as rough roads can quickly worsen issues. It's also wise to have your brakes and tire tread depth checked more frequently than standard recommendations, given the extra strain from stopping on loose surfaces.
Labor rates may be slightly lower than in Omaha or Council Bluffs, but parts availability can sometimes affect cost and timeline. For specialized parts, local shops may need to order them, which can add a day for shipping, so it's good to plan for potential minor delays.
Prepare for Iowa's harsh winters by ensuring your battery, antifreeze, and wipers are serviced in fall, as cold snaps can be severe. Conversely, spring is a crucial time to check for undercarriage corrosion from winter road salt and to clean out debris from gravel road driving that can trap moisture and cause rust.
